Introduction

Over the previous 5 a long time, the digital gaming business has quickly expanded, changing into a major cultural and financial drive worldwide. Since the launch of early consoles just like the Atari 2600 in 1977, gaming has reworked right into a pervasive type of leisure and competitors.1 However, alongside these developments, considerations about potential unfavorable well being outcomes—significantly relating to musculoskeletal (MSK) well being—have emerged. Increasing proof means that extended gaming periods, mixed with poor ergonomics and sedentary conduct, are related to a excessive burden of MSK ache throughout ages and ranges of play.2

Consistent with this, a latest assessment discovered that almost all research determine gaming as related to MSK complaints.3 International knowledge likewise present excessive charges of 77.8% MSK ache in players.4 In line with the worldwide image, in Saudi Arabia, a latest survey reported MSK ache in 86.2% of aggressive players.5

Gamers generally expertise MSK ache within the neck, decrease again, shoulders, higher again, and wrists/palms. This ache is related to extended static postures similar to forward-head posture, repetitive actions like mouse clicks and keystrokes, and poor ergonomics associated to watch and desk peak, which might worsen the chance of pressure and damage.6 Additionally, private traits similar to gender and age appear to affect susceptibility to MSK ache. Female players, as an illustration, are likely to report larger ache charges, doubtlessly as a consequence of organic, psychosocial, and ergonomic elements.5,7 Moreover, prolonged gaming length has been linked to elevated MSK ache in each genders.8,9 Age and way of life elements, similar to sedentary behaviors frequent amongst older adults and people in superior academic or occupational roles, might additional exacerbate the chance of MSK ache.2,10

In addition to non-public elements, particular gaming-related variables additionally play a important position within the improvement of MSK ache. For occasion, a latest examine of smartphone-based play-to-earn players confirmed excessive charges of MSK issues, suggesting that each the gaming platform and goal can affect threat.11 Competitive standing might have an effect on MSK ache threat, with skilled players experiencing better pressure as a consequence of longer and extra structured coaching routines.5 In distinction, non-professional players usually have decrease publicity. Studies spotlight that structured coaching in esports will increase MSK threat, supporting the necessity to assess variations between gamer subgroups to develop tailor-made ergonomic and preventive methods.8 Moreover, system sort has emerged as a key determinant, with desktop and laptop computer customers continuously reporting decrease again ache, whereas smartphone and pill customers extra generally expertise neck and shoulder discomfort as a consequence of poor posture.3 Virtual actuality (VR) gaming additionally presents distinctive ergonomic challenges; extended standing and repetitive head and neck actions in VR environments have been linked to larger charges of decrease again and neck ache.12,13 When contemplating sport genres, sure sorts—similar to puzzle video games—might contribute to localized MSK discomfort as a consequence of extended high-quality motor engagement and static posture necessities.14 Such genres typically require sustained hand positioning or mouse use, which might stress particular muscle teams and joints.Recent literature highlights how repetitive high-quality motor actions, significantly in puzzle video games, can result in tendinopathy and localized ache. In distinction, motion-controlled and sports-racing video games have been related to shoulder and higher limb pressure as a consequence of their repetitive and forceful motion calls for.15

Given the rising reputation of gaming and accumulating proof of its potential well being impacts, a extra detailed understanding of MSK ache contributors amongst players is warranted. Previous analysis has largely centered on remoted elements and particular populations,5,8,10 leaving gaps in our understanding of how private traits and gaming habits work together to have an effect on MSK outcomes. This situation is especially related in Saudi Arabia, the place gaming has expanded quickly and nationwide coverage has made esports a strategic precedence; development and governance are being actively steered to place the Kingdom as a world hub,16 but the well being implications stay under-investigated. To handle this hole, the present examine investigated the prevalence and places of MSK ache amongst Saudi players and examined its predictors, specializing in how demographic and gaming-related variables—similar to sport style, system sort, gaming length, {and professional} gaming standing—contributed to ache outcomes. We hypothesized that sure variables, significantly skilled gaming standing and particular sport genres, would considerably predict larger MSK ache prevalence as a consequence of extended publicity, repetitive actions, and insufficient ergonomic situations. We additional hypothesized that the neck and higher limbs would display better ache prevalence in comparison with different physique areas, given their steady involvement in frequent gaming actions.

Materials and Methods

Research Design and Sampling

This analytic cross-sectional descriptive examine was carried out utilizing a self-administered web-based questionnaire designed with Microsoft Forms between February and April 2024. The examine included grownup players (≥18 years) in Saudi Arabia, each skilled and leisure players of all genders. Individuals with a historical past of fractures up to now six months, pre-existing medical situations, surgical historical past, bodily disabilities, or cognitive impairments had been excluded from the examine.

Professional players had been outlined as people formally registered with the Saudi Esports Federation who compete for awards and financial prizes. While non-professional players participated in gaming purely for leisure with none formal aggressive affiliation.

A non-probability comfort sampling methodology was employed, and the required pattern dimension was decided to be 384 individuals primarily based on OpenEpi, making certain a 5% margin of error at a 95% confidence stage.

Participants had been invited by means of Email and WhatsApp. Professional players had been contacted utilizing data obtained from the Saudi Esports Federation (SEF) registry, whereas non-professional players had been invited by means of the dissemination of the questionnaire through social media platforms.

Data Collection Tool

Data had been collected by means of a web-based questionnaire comprising two major parts. The first part centered on demographic data and gaming traits. Participants supplied background knowledge similar to age, gender, training stage, occupation, and marital standing. The frequency of digital gaming per week, common day by day gaming time, registration with the SEF, participation in native or nationwide tournaments, the kinds or genres of digital video games performed, and the gadgets used for gaming (eg, smartphones, consoles, or PCs). To guarantee content material validity, the survey was reviewed by three specialists in musculoskeletal well being and gaming conduct and piloted with 5 individuals to evaluate readability, circulation, and the performance of branching logic. Professional players reported each aggressive and leisure sport genres to mirror their full vary of gaming exercise.

The second part of the questionnaire featured the Extended Nordic Musculoskeletal Questionnaire (NMQ-E), utilized to evaluate MSK ache. The Arabic model of the NMQ-E was employed on this examine, with prior permission obtained from the unique authors.17 The NMQ-E assessed musculoskeletal ache throughout 9 anatomical areas: neck, higher again, decrease again, shoulder, elbow, hand/wrist, hip, knee, and ankle/foot.18 A physique map diagram was included to help individuals in precisely figuring out ache places. The questionnaire measured ache prevalence at 4 closing dates: lifetime, annual, month-to-month, and level prevalence, whereas additionally analyzing the implications of ache, similar to interference with work, healthcare visits, remedy use, absenteeism, and hospitalization. Response choices had been binary (“yes” or “no”). The NMQ-E has demonstrated sturdy reliability and validity in evaluating musculoskeletal signs and their penalties.18 The Arabic model has additionally proven robust content material and assemble validity, together with excessive test-retest reliability.18 Furthermore, lifetime prevalence responses had been numerically coded (1 for “Yes,” 0 for “No”) to compute a complete rating that displays the variety of painful physique websites.

Statistical Analysis

Statistical evaluation was performed utilizing SPSS software program (model 27.0). Descriptive outcomes are offered as means ± customary deviation (SD) and in percentages. For the affiliation evaluation, physique areas with a prevalence of MSK ache of 20% or larger—particularly the neck, higher again, decrease again, shoulders, and wrists/palms—had been chosen for additional examination. The associations amongst categorical variables, together with gender, system sort, prize positive factors, and varieties of video games performed, had been evaluated utilizing Pearson’s chi-square take a look at (X2). The impact dimension was measured utilizing Cramér’s V Phi coefficient (φ) for categorical associations and interpreted in line with established pointers. Where associations had been recognized, odds ratios (OR) with 95% confidence intervals (CI) had been calculated. Eta was used to evaluate the connection between categorical and interval variables, with interpretation primarily based on standard cutoffs reported within the literature.19 Binary logistic regression evaluation was performed to find out the predictive worth of the chosen demographic and gaming-related elements on MSK ache outcomes, adjusting for potential confounders. Three fashions had been performed for every physique area: Model 1 (unadjusted) analyzed every predictor individually with out covariate adjustment; Model 2 (age- and gender-adjusted) included solely age and gender as predictors to evaluate their impartial results; and Model 3 (totally adjusted) concurrently included all predictors—age, gender, gaming publicity, system sort, and sport genres—inside a multivariable mannequin. In these fashions, age was handled as a steady variable, and gender was entered as a binary categorical variable (male = 0, feminine = 1). Relevant demographic and gaming-related variables had been entered into the multivariable regression mannequin to look at their associations with musculoskeletal ache. A subgroup comparability between skilled and non-professional male players was performed to account for gender confounding, as all skilled players within the pattern had been male and gender was recognized as a major predictor of MSK ache. The significance stage was set at a p-value of <0.05.

Results

In this examine, a complete of 641 people had been approached, with 593 individuals included within the evaluation. The remaining 48 respondents had been excluded for numerous causes: 14 selected to not take part, 9 had been disqualified as a consequence of age, 15 had a historical past of musculoskeletal accidents up to now six months, 7 had undergone latest surgical procedures, and three didn’t have interaction in digital gaming (Figure 1).

Figure 1 Flow Chart of Inclusion and Exclusion of the Study.

Demographics

The current study involved 593 participants, the majority of whom were male (71.3%), with an average age of 25.70± (8.980) years. Most participants primarily resided in the Central Region (65.3%). As illustrated in Table 1, a good portion of the individuals held a bachelor’s diploma (67.8%), with half figuring out as college students (50.4%), and a big majority being single (80.8%).

Table 1 Demographics and Gaming Behavior

The study also explored the characteristics of the gamers. Among the participants, 43.7% reported involvement in local or national tournaments, while 30.9% indicated they had won prizes. Additionally, 37.4% were registered with the Saudi Esports Federation as members of a team. When it came to preferred gaming devices, most players (33.4%) used personal computers. In terms of input devices, a substantial number of gamers (55.3%) favored controllers. Notably, 58.2% of players reported gaming for more than four hours each day, with the average gaming duration among participants being 4.83±2.07 hours. Moreover, First Person Shooters (FPS) are the most popular genre (65.1%). This is followed by Competitive (33.7%) and Sports/Racing (33.1%). Role-Playing Games (RPGs) and Card/Board also show notable popularity (28.3% and 28.2%, respectively). (Table 1).

Prevalence and Consequences of Musculoskeletal Pain

The majority of examine individuals reported experiencing MSK ache in no less than one physique area, particularly 78.2%, with a better prevalence noticed amongst females (86.47%) in comparison with males (74.95%). The most continuously affected areas of MSK ache over a lifetime included the neck (49.4%), decrease again (40.0%), shoulder (29.7%), higher again (25.3%), and hand/wrist (24.5%). The neck additionally had the longest length of reported ache, averaging 4.6 years, adopted carefully by the shoulder and decrease again, each with a median length of 4.4 years (Table 2). Participants reported a variety of affected physique areas as a consequence of MSK ache, various from one to 9, with the bulk experiencing ache in both one (22.3%) or two (18.5%) areas.

Table 2 Prevalence of Musculoskeletal Pain by Period for Each Region

Table 3 illustrates the affect of MSK ache amongst individuals. While hospitalization charges as a consequence of musculoskeletal ache had been comparatively low, knee ache was essentially the most continuously reported at 8.8%, adopted carefully by elbow ache at 8.3%. The impact of musculoskeletal ache on exercise and participation was significantly important for ankle and foot ache (52.3%), adopted by knee ache (49.5%) and neck ache (43.9%). Additionally, the interference of ache with day by day dwelling actions was notably reported for neck ache (33.9%), knee ache (30.1%), and ankle/foot ache (29.2%). Visits to healthcare practitioners (HCPs) as a consequence of MSK ache had been predominantly related to ankle/foot points (29.2%), neck issues (23.8%), and knee ache (20.3%). Furthermore, the necessity for remedy to handle MSK ache was most linked to ankle/foot ache (29.2%), neck ache (26.7%), and hip ache (25.7%).

Table 3 Prevalence of Musculoskeletal Pain Consequences for Each Region

The Association Between Musculoskeletal Pain and Personal or Gaming Factors

Correlation analysis between pain location and participant demographics uncovered several statistically significant associations (Table 4).

Table 4 Association of Pain Location and Sample Characteristics

Gender was significantly associated with MSK pain. For neck pain, a significant association and large effect size was observed (χ2=15.973, df=1, p<0.001, V=0.16); with males had lower odds (OR = 0.478, 95% CI [0.332, 0.689]). A similar pattern was observed for wrist/hand pain, with a significant association (χ2=12.053, df=1, p=0.001; V=0.14). Males had lower odds of experiencing wrist/hand pain (OR=0.500, 95% CI 0.337–0.724). Additionally, shoulder pain showed a significant association with sex and a moderate effect size, with females more likely than males to report shoulder pain (χ2=39.317, df=1, p<0.002; V=0.13).

When evaluating the impact of age on MSK pain, the results indicate a moderate relationship between age and pain in the shoulder and lower back, with Eta values of 0.374 and 0.313, respectively. A weak-to-moderate relationship was identified between age and neck pain, reflected by an Eta value of 0.291. Furthermore, a relatively weak relationship was noted between age and pain in the upper back, hands, upper limbs, and back, with Eta values of 0.235, 0.264, 0.254, and 0.268, respectively.

In addition, significant associations were found between MSK pain and gaming-related variables. The type of device used was associated with shoulder pain (X2 = 22.386, df = 1, p <0.001, V = 0.19). Prizes won demonstrated a moderate association with neck pain (X2 = 9.959, df = 1, p =0.002, V = 0.13) and a strong association with shoulder pain (X2 = 22.386, df = 1, p <0.001, V = 0.19). Moreover, neck and upper limb pain exhibited a moderate correlation with prizes won (X2 = 6.709, df = 1, p =0.010, V = 0.10).

To investigate the association between daily gaming hours and pain experienced in different body regions, Eta values were computed to evaluate the strength of these relationships. The findings indicated various levels of correlation, with the strongest associations identified for wrist and hand pain, as well as combined neck and upper limb pain, both showing an Eta value of 0.396. In contrast, lower back and shoulder pain demonstrated weaker correlations.

The Association Between Musculoskeletal Pain and Game Type/Genre

The correlation analysis examining the relationship between pain location and game type uncovered several significant findings. Puzzle games were notably linked to various pain regions, with the exception of wrist and hand pain. In contrast, sports and racing games displayed significant correlations with pain in the shoulder and upper back. However, no significant associations were identified between any pain regions and virtual reality (VR), role-playing games (RPG), massively multiplayer online (MMO), or competitive game types (Table 5).

Table 5 Associations Between Pain Location and Game Type/Genre Played

Regression Analysis

Binary logistic regression identified predictors of MSK pain across five regions. In unadjusted Model 1 analyses, female sex was associated with higher odds of neck, shoulder, wrist/hand, and lower-back pain, while age showed region-specific effects.

In the age- and gender-adjusted models (Model 2), female gender remained significantly associated with pain in the neck (OR = 2.06, 95% CI: 1.43–2.98, p < 0.001), shoulder (OR = 3.23, 95% CI: 2.18–4.77, p < 0.001), wrist/hand (OR = 2.02, 95% CI: 1.36–3.00, p < 0.001), and lower back (OR = 1.75, 95% CI: 1.22–2.51, p = 0.003). Gender was not significantly associated with upper back pain (p = 0.544). Age was a significant predictor of shoulder pain (OR = 1.06, 95% CI: 1.04–1.08, p < 0.001), and a borderline association was observed for lower back pain (OR = 1.02, 95% CI: 1.00–1.04, p = 0.051). No significant association was found between age and pain in the neck, upper back, or wrist/hand regions. Model 2 results are presented in Table 6.

Table 6 Age- and Gender-Adjusted Logistic Regression Results for Predictors of Musculoskeletal Pain Across Body Regions

In the fully adjusted models (Model 3), which included all demographic variables, gaming exposure, and game genres, gender and age remained significantly associated with MSK pain in several regions. Female participants had higher odds of reporting pain in the neck (OR = 2.080, p = 0.002), shoulders (OR = 2.426, p < 0.001), upper back (OR = 2.426, p = 0.001), and lower back (OR = 1.787, p = 0.014) compared to males. Increasing age was also associated with higher odds of pain in the shoulders (OR = 1.047, p < 0.001). No significant associations were found between device type (eg, laptop, PlayStation), tool used (eg, keyboard/mouse, touch), or average gaming hours per day and pain in any of the examined regions.

Several game genres were significantly associated with MSK pain. Puzzle games were a consistent predictor, associated with increased odds of pain in the neck (OR = 1.189, p = 0.008), shoulders (OR = 2.459, p < 0.001), and lower back (OR = 1.839, p = 0.009). Participants who frequently played first-person shooter (FPS) games had higher odds of reporting wrist and hand pain (OR = 1.920, p = 0.010). Likewise, sports/racing games were significantly associated with both upper back pain (OR = 1.627, p = 0.026) and lower back pain (OR = 1.532, p = 0.035). Conversely, engagement with fighting games was associated with lower odds of pain in the shoulders (OR = 0.441, p = 0.010). Notably, VR games were associated with a reduced likelihood of neck pain (OR = 0.364, p = 0.004), potentially reflecting different physical demands compared to sedentary gaming styles. Other genres such as strategy, simulation, role-playing, MMO, and platformers did not show significant associations with pain in any region (Table 7).

Table 7 Binary Logistic Regression Models for Predictors of Gamers’ Musculoskeletal Pain

Comparison of Pain Locations and Consequences Between Professional and Non-Professional Male Gamers

Table 8 compares the prevalence of MSK ache between skilled and non-professional players throughout numerous physique areas. The statistical evaluation confirmed no important variations between the 2 teams relating to the variety of ache websites or particular ache places. A chi-square take a look at was utilized to match the prevalence of MSK ache in 5 key physique areas. Among these areas, higher again ache revealed no statistically important distinction between skilled and non-professional male players (X2 = 0.656, df = 1, p =0.418), with a negligible impact dimension (φ = 0.04) and comparable odds of experiencing ache (OR = 0.871, 95% CI [0.624, 1.216]).

Table 8 Comparison Between Professional and Non-Professional Gamers

In contrast, significant associations were noted in the other body regions assessed. Neck pain was found to be more prevalent among non-professional gamers than their professional counterparts (X2 = 5.666, df = 1, p =0.017), with a small effect size (φ = 0.12) and lower odds for professionals (OR = 0.771, 95% CI [0.524, 1.136]). A similar trend was identified for shoulder pain, which was significantly higher in non-professional gamers (X2 = 8.343, df = 1, p =0.004) and demonstrated a moderate effect size (φ = 0.14). Professionals exhibited lower odds of experiencing shoulder pain (OR = 0.588, 95% CI [0.377, 0.916]). Additionally, lower back pain was less prevalent among professionals compared to non-professionals, with a significant difference (X2 = 6.718, df = 1, p =0.010), a small effect size (φ = 0.13), and reduced odds of pain (OR = 0.714, 95% CI [0.552, 0.923]). Conversely, wrist and hand pain was significantly more common among professional gamers (X2 = 4.036, df = 1, p =0.045), with a small effect size (φ = 0.10) and increased odds of experiencing pain compared to non-professionals (OR = 1.482, 95% CI [1.004, 2.186]).

Discussion

This study explored the prevalence and predictors of MSK pain among gamers, with particular attention to pain locations and how demographic and gaming-related factors contributed to these outcomes. A majority of participants reported experiencing MSK pain in at least one area of their body, with the neck, lower back, shoulders, upper back, and wrists/hands being the most commonly affected regions. Neck pain was identified as the most disruptive to daily activities, followed by lower back and wrist/hand pain—areas that are crucial for mobility and everyday tasks. Although hospitalizations were relatively rare, they were most frequently associated with lower back pain, followed by neck and shoulder pain. Interestingly, professional gamers were significantly less likely to report neck, shoulder, and lower back pain, although wrist/hand pain was more prevalent in this group. No significant differences were observed between groups for upper back pain.

Many gamers reported seeking healthcare services and using medications, indicating the chronic nature of pain in some cases. However, it is important to note that literature specifically investigating hospitalization, healthcare visits, and medication use in gamers is still scarce. In this study, gender, age, and certain game genres emerged as significant predictors of MSK pain.5

Gender emerged as a constant threat issue, with feminine players considerably extra more likely to report ache within the neck, shoulders, higher again, and decrease again. These findings align with broader literature noting gender-related variations in MSK ache, doubtlessly influenced by physiological, ergonomic, or hormonal elements. This sample is supported by Wijnhoven et al (2006), who linked larger MSK ache prevalence in females to hormonal, physiological, and psychosocial elements.20 Similarly, Fathuldeen et al (2023) discovered that neck, decrease again, and palms/wrists had been essentially the most painful areas for players, areas closely engaged throughout gaming periods.5 Cankurtaran et al (2022) additional demonstrated that females, regardless of enjoying lower than males, reported larger charges of head, hand/wrist, and again ache.21 Additionally, Arvidsson et al (2020) highlighted the position of psychosocial elements and ergonomics in MSK ache amongst females.7 Such patterns underscore the significance of incorporating gender-specific ergonomic training and focused interventions. Nevertheless, additional analysis is required to make clear gender-specific threat elements, particularly given the underrepresentation of feminine players. Age was positively related to ache within the shoulders, indicating that even inside a comparatively younger gaming inhabitants, age-related vulnerability exists and will compound ergonomic pressure. This examine’s findings agree with Lindberg et al (2020), who prompt that older adults typically keep poor ergonomics throughout work and leisure actions, which, mixed with age-related physiological adjustments and sedentary habits, might enhance MSK susceptibility.2

Beyond demographic influences, gameplay style emerged as an vital determinant of MSK ache. In addition to non-public elements, particular gaming-related variables—significantly sport style—had been related to MSK ache in a number of physique areas. Puzzle, FPS, and sports activities/racing video games confirmed important associations with ache within the neck, decrease again, and wrists/palms, highlighting the potential affect of particular sport genres on bodily pressure. Virtual actuality (VR) gaming stood out, with individuals reporting appreciable neck and decrease again ache, seemingly as a consequence of extended standing and head actions. Gregory et al (2008) discovered that standing for 2 hours with out relaxation may end in decrease again ache.12 Furthermore, Tyrrell et al (2018) linked VR gameplay to extreme neck and head movement, which can worsen pre-existing situations.13 Puzzle video games had been a constant predictor throughout a number of areas, whereas sports activities/racing and FPS video games had been additionally related to particular ache areas, similar to decrease again and wrist/hand. Conversely, preventing video games had been related to decrease odds of shoulder and higher again ache.

These findings emphasize the significance of contemplating sport style as a central issue when evaluating MSK ache threat amongst players. Puzzle video games, FPS, and sports activities/racing genres confirmed constant associations with ache in a number of physique areas, underscoring the necessity for genre-specific prevention methods. Ergonomic interventions that handle extended static postures, repetitive inputs, and system use—tailor-made to frequent patterns inside particular sport genres—might assist scale back MSK burden in gaming populations.15,22,23 This highlights the necessity for genre-specific ergonomic pointers, as sure sport mechanics might place disproportionate pressure on the musculoskeletal system.

In addition to sport style, the kind of system and the ergonomics of its use additionally performed a important position in shaping MSK outcomes. Although system sort initially confirmed a major affiliation with shoulder and wrist/hand ache within the bivariate evaluation, this relationship didn’t stay important after adjusting for covariates within the regression fashions. This means that system sort might not independently contribute to MSK ache threat, however as a substitute could also be confounded by different elements similar to gender, sport style, or enter methodology. This interpretation is supported by Gholami et al (2025), who discovered excessive charges of MSK issues amongst smartphone-based play-to-earn players, indicating that each platform and gaming motivation can affect musculoskeletal outcomes.11 However, general, the system appeared to outweigh the sport style in figuring out MSK ache dangers. Alnuman et al (2022) concluded that system sort was a important think about MSK ache prevalence, a conclusion supported by our findings.22

While the regression fashions counsel system sort might not independently drive MSK ache, ergonomics associated to system use stay a decisive issue. Consistent with Geer et al (2023), poor posture, lengthy gaming hours, and sleep disruption considerably exacerbate MSK ache threat. Taken collectively, these findings assist the necessity for ergonomic coaching, adaptive seating, and scheduled breaks, significantly in high-risk system contexts.23 Alnuman et al (2022) additionally discovered larger ache charges amongst players in comparison with non-gamers, significantly within the higher physique, reinforcing the affect of device-specific pressure patterns noticed within the present examine.22 Tholl et al (2022) recognized smartphones and tablets as frequent contributors to neck and shoulder ache as a consequence of hunched postures.3 While these device-specific patterns had been famous, the adjusted regression mannequin means that system sort alone will not be an impartial predictor of MSK ache. Despite these observations, analysis on device-specific MSK ache patterns stays restricted.

Similar to the present examine, a number of investigations have highlighted excessive charges of MSK ache amongst skilled players, significantly affecting the neck, shoulders, and decrease again. Lindberg et al (2020) reported that 42.6% of Danish esports athletes skilled MSK ache, whereas DiFrancisco-Donoghue et al (2019) noticed analogous developments amongst collegiate gamers.2,24 Goh et al (2023) corroborated these dangers in a scientific assessment; nevertheless, none of those research included non-professional players for comparability.1

In distinction to earlier analysis, our findings revealed important variations within the prevalence of ache throughout numerous areas. Non-professional players had been extra more likely to report neck, shoulder, and decrease again ache, whereas wrist and hand ache had been extra prevalent amongst skilled players. Notably, higher again ache confirmed no important variations between the 2 teams. These outcomes diverge from these of Reeves et al (2024), who discovered no distinctions in MSK dysfunction indicators between skilled and informal players, suggesting that the interaction between professionalization, ergonomics, and ache is complicated and deserves additional examine.25 The present findings counsel that whereas aggressive standing might affect ache in particular areas, different elements—similar to extended sitting, poor ergonomics, and repetitive pressure—are seemingly important contributors for all sorts of players.9 It is vital to acknowledge that the gender distribution differed between the skilled and non-professional teams in our pattern, which can have influenced our comparisons. Future analysis ought to undertake stratified or matched designs to extra successfully isolate the consequences of gender {and professional} standing on musculoskeletal outcomes. These findings spotlight the necessity for tailor-made prevention methods that think about each gaming roles and ergonomic dangers, making certain assist for musculoskeletal well being no matter skilled standing. The scientific implications are important, as early identification and intervention for at-risk players may assist mitigate long-term musculoskeletal points and improve useful outcomes.

Recognizing that each skilled and informal players are susceptible to MSK issues highlights the significance of well being promotion applications, workplace-style ergonomic training, and early screening in gaming populations. This is especially important within the Saudi Arabian context, the place gaming is quickly increasing as each a leisure exercise and knowledgeable pursuit. Cultural elements—similar to extended sedentary conduct, preferences for indoor leisure, and evolving health-seeking behaviors—might uniquely affect each ache prevalence and healthcare utilization amongst Saudi players. These contextual components improve the applicability of the findings regionally, whereas additionally offering a precious perspective for international comparisons in gaming-related MSK analysis.

While this examine supplies vital insights into the connection between gaming behaviors and MSK ache amongst Saudi players, a number of methodological issues warrant consideration. Its cross-sectional design limits causal inference, and reliance on self-reported knowledge might introduce recall or reporting biases. Future research would profit from longitudinal designs to evaluate causality, the incorporation of goal ergonomic/postural measures, and consideration of cumulative publicity (complete years of gaming). Furthermore, objectively assessing ache severity, useful incapacity, and comorbidities similar to sleep disturbance or sedentary way of life may add important scientific relevance. Given the underrepresentation of feminine players and the fast development of e-sports in Saudi Arabia, additional gender-sensitive and culturally contextualized analysis is warranted. Additionally, the noticed variations between skilled and non-professional players have to be interpreted with warning, as gender imbalance throughout teams seemingly influenced prevalence patterns. The use of comfort sampling and exclusion of people with prior accidents might restrict generalizability. Cultural elements distinctive to the Saudi context, similar to gaming preferences and health-seeking conduct, advantage additional exploration. Future analysis would profit from incorporating comparative experimental designs with management variables to allow stronger causal interpretation.

Conclusions

This examine revealed a notable prevalence of MSK ache amongst players in Saudi Arabia, with essentially the most generally affected areas being the neck, decrease again, shoulders, higher again, and wrists/palms. Pain incidence was influenced by numerous elements, together with gender, age, and sport genres. Notably, puzzle, FPS, and sports-racing video games had been related to heightened discomfort ranges, whereas digital actuality gaming was considerably linked to neck ache. These findings underscore that MSK issues are frequent amongst players and that particular person traits and genre-specific calls for are important predictors, supporting the necessity for ergonomic training and gender-sensitive prevention applications. While the examine presents precious insights, its reliance on a younger, culturally particular pattern and self-reported knowledge limits generalizability, highlighting the necessity for future work with numerous populations and goal scientific measures. Future analysis ought to undertake longitudinal and interventional designs to check ergonomic methods and higher set up causal relationships. In conclusion, this examine emphasizes the widespread incidence of MSK ache amongst players and the significance of culturally contextualized, evidence-based approaches to prevention and intervention.
